Most Expensive Electric Bikes

At the luxury end, electric bikes come loaded with cutting-edge components, carbon fiber frames, integrated smart technology, and powerful motors. Prices can soar above $5,000, reflecting their premium craftsmanship and exclusivity. These e-bikes often incorporate proprietary suspension systems, high-capacity batteries offering 60+ miles per charge, and digital integration such as GPS, fitness tracking, or smartphone connectivity. Buyers in this segment prioritize performance, brand prestige, and advanced engineering.
